Effortless Strawberry Cookies: 4-Ingredient Magic



Recipe Information

    • Prep Time: 10 minutes
    • Cook Time: 12 minutes
    • Total Time: 22 minutes
    • Servings: 12 cookies
    • Difficulty: Easy

Ingredients

    • 1 cup strawberry jam (or strawberry preserves)
    • ½ cup unsalted butter, softened
    • 1 large egg
    • 1 cup all‑purpose flour

Instructions

Below, the step‑by‑step guide shows how the Effortless Strawberry Cookies come together thanks to the 4-Ingredient Magic that makes the dough silky and the strawberries shine.

    • Prepare the oven and pan.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per or a silicone mat to prevent sticking and ensure even browning.
    • Cream butter and jam. In a large mixing bowl, add the softened butter and strawberry jam. Using a handheld mixer or a sturdy spoon, beat the mixture until it becomes light, fluffy, and slightly glossy, about 1–2 minutes. This incorporates air and creates a tender crumb.
    • Add the egg. Crack the egg into the bowl and continue beating until the egg is fully incorporated. The mixture should look smooth and uniform, with no streaks of egg white remaining.
    • Incorporate the flour. Sprinkle the all‑purpose flour over the wet ingredients. Gently fold the flour in with a spatula, mixing just until a soft dough forms. Over‑mixing can develop gluten and make the cookies tough, so stop as soon as the flour disappears.
    • Portion the dough. Using a tablespoon or a small ice‑cream scoop, drop rounded portions onto the prepared baking sheet, spacing them about 2 inches apart. This spacing allows the cookies to spread slightly without merging.
    • Bake to perfection. Place the sheet in the preheated oven and bake for 10–12 minutes, or until the edges turn a light golden hue while the centers remain soft. Keep an eye on them; ovens vary, and you want a just‑right bake.
    • Cool briefly. Remove the cookies from the oven and let them rest on the sheet for 5 minutes. This short cooling period helps them set without crumbling.
    • Transfer and cool completely. Move the cookies to a wire rack to cool completely. As they cool, they will firm up and develop a delicate, melt‑in‑your‑mouth texture.

Pro Tips & Notes

    • For a deeper strawberry flavor, use a high‑quality jam made with real fruit and minimal added sugar.
    • If you prefer a gluten‑free version, substitute the all‑purpose flour with a 1:1 gluten‑free blend; the texture remains surprisingly tender.
    • To add a hint of citrus, zest a small amount of lemon or orange into the dough before mixing.
    • These cookies stay fresh for up to 4 days when stored in an airtight container at room temperature.
    • For a decorative touch, press a tiny slice of fresh strawberry onto the top of each cookie before baking.

Frequently Asked Questions

    • Can I use jelly instead of jam? Yes, any strawberry jelly works, but jam provides a slightly thicker texture that holds the dough together better.
    • What can I substitute for the egg? A flaxseed “egg” (1 tablespoon ground flaxseed mixed with 3 tablespoons water, let sit 5 minutes) works as a vegan alternative.
    • How do I store leftovers? Keep cookies in an airtight container with a paper towel layer to absorb any excess moisture; they stay soft for several days.
    • Can I freeze the dough? Absolutely. Portion the dough, freeze on a tray, then transfer to a freezer bag. Bake from frozen, adding 1–2 minutes to the baking time.
